About the Event

One of the oldest festivals in the area. The medieval hamlet of Preazzano hosts food stalls where the aubergine takes centre stage, including the sweet chocolate variation. A shuttle is available from Vico Equense station.

Preazzano, a small medieval hamlet in the heart of the Sorrentine Peninsula, transforms for two days into an open-air food laboratory. The local aubergine is served in dozens of variations: fried, stuffed, alla parmigiana and the surprising sweet chocolate version.

The Festival Specialities

Savory variations

The traditional aubergine

Fried, stuffed, alla parmigiana, in pasta and in Campanian ragù: the aubergine is the protagonist of a dozen traditional recipes from the Sorrentine culinary tradition.

Sweet chocolate version

The unmissable surprise

Aubergine in chocolate is the surprising speciality that attracts visitors from all over Campania: slices of fried aubergine covered in dark chocolate - an unexpected combination that works perfectly.
